How to Add a Menu with Elementor

Table of Contents

Elementor is a powerful page builder that simplifies website design and development for WordPress users. With its drag-and-drop interface, you can easily create stunning websites without writing a single line of code. However, when it comes to adding a menu to your website, you may face some challenges. In this blog post, we will show you how to add a menu with Elementor in just a few simple steps.

Step 1: Create a Header Template

The first step in adding a menu to your website with Elementor is to create a header template. To do this, go to Templates -> Theme Builder -> Header. You will be prompted to choose a header type. Select the header type that matches your website design. You can choose from several pre-designed header templates or create a custom header from scratch.

Step 2: Add a Menu Widget

After creating the header template, it’s time to add a menu widget to your header. To do this, drag and drop the Menu widget from the Elementor widget panel to your header template. You can customize the appearance of the menu by changing the font, color, size, and layout. You can also choose to display submenus, add icons to menu items, and more.

Step 3: Assign Menu and Save Changes

Once you have added the Menu widget, the next step is to assign a menu to it. To do this, click on the Menu widget and select the menu you want to display. You can choose from the menus you have created in WordPress or create a new menu. After choosing the menu, save the changes.

Step 4: Assign Header to Pages

The final step in adding a menu to your website with Elementor is to assign the header template to the pages you want it to appear on. To do this, go to the Pages section of WordPress and edit the page you want to assign the header to. Scroll down to the Page Attributes section and select the header you want to assign from the drop-down menu.

Step 5: Preview and Publish

After completing all the above steps, preview your website to see the new menu in action. If you are satisfied with the changes, publish the website. Congratulations! You have successfully added a new menu to your website with Elementor.
